Automatic parking lifts serve as innovative solutions for urban spaces. According to industry reports, about 30% of urban land is used for parking. This underlines the need for advanced parking management. These automatic lifts can save up to 60% of space compared to traditional parking systems.
When analyzing different models, factors such as capacity, efficiency, and user-friendliness become crucial. Some lifts can accommodate up to 2000 kg of vehicles and stack them up to six levels high. These systems reduce parking time significantly, often by up to 50%. Choosing the right model depends on specific needs and space constraints.

When installing an automatic parking lift, preparation is key. Start by assessing the available space. Measure the dimensions meticulously. This ensures that the lift fits properly. Check the building's structural integrity as well. A reputable installer often points this out. It’s not just about the lift; it’s about creating a safe environment.
Maintenance plays a vital role in the longevity of parking lifts. Regular inspections are necessary. This includes checking hydraulic systems and electrical connections. You should also clean the lift regularly. Dirt and debris can hinder its function. Setting a maintenance schedule can help prevent costly repairs. Remember to train staff on proper use too. “Since 2019, we have been running the Limata X1000 LDI system (including LUVIR for solder mask imaging) in daily production as an addition to our current process with film. The machine was capable of properly exposing Taiyo PSR-4000 BN (DI) solder mask types on normal to high-copper boards using a new and unique direct imaging process. The machine operating interface is very user friendly which allowed for a quick technical training curve. The pre-registration processing reduced several seconds of production time at every print. Limata support and service staff is incomparable. They supported our team every step of the way at basically any time of the day or night, with literally, an immediate response time, customizing the software interface to best fit our Operations and needs.
We have exposed more than 8,000 prints since end of October, on various solder mask colors and some resist film panels. Limata, has proven to be very capable and innovative. They are a strong contender in the industry.

As a replacement to our current contact exposure process with film, the LIMATA X2000 system including LUVIR-Technology was capable of properly exposing non-LDI solder mask types using a direct imaging process. The machine offers cutting edge software with a very intuitive operating interface which allowed for quick technician training curve. The dual drawer system combined with pre-registration processing reduced several seconds of production time at every machine cycle. Limata support and service staff is world class. They added software patches to keep production running at shortest possible response times, customized the software interface to best fit our in-house Operations system, and even wrote a step-by-step machine processing manual. As a result of the project, we have exposed more than 16,000 times on various product types and solder mask brands/colors.
